Key "on" drains battery
My mom's EZGO golf cart routinely gets left with the key in the ignition and in the 'on' position with no trouble. She gets on and goes.
If I leave the key 'on' in my EZGO cart overnight, it drains the batteries. Yes, I know the directions say to turn the key off, put in neutral, etc. and I try to remember to do that every time, but if something distracts me, I forget on occasion and come back to a dead cart. Since my mom's (basically identical) cart doesn't do that, is there something wrong with hers... or mine? Is there something in the wiring that could be causing this discrepancy? Any suggestions on what to look for, would be appreciated. If it can't be changed, I don't want to spend a lot of time and effort trying to fix something that isn't broken. Thank you. |
